01 / The backstory
What actually happened to Modsy?
Modsy was one of the best-known names in online interior design. Founded in 2015 by former Google Ventures partner Shanna Tellerman, it paired you with a real designer and returned a photorealistic 3D render of your room filled with furniture you could actually buy, sourced from brands like West Elm and Crate & Barrel. It raised more than $72 million in funding over its lifetime.
Then it stopped. In late June 2022, Tellerman announced Modsy was shutting down its design services, laying off designers with only a few days' notice, and the company ceased operations around July 6 after an expected acquisition deal collapsed at the last minute. Customers mid-project lost access to their designers and 3D models, furniture orders were left in limbo, and refund requests were funneled into a Google Form, with some customers still awaiting refunds weeks later.
So if you have landed here searching for Modsy, the short version is: it is gone, and it is not coming back. Did Modsy shut down, and what happened?
Yes. Modsy, the online interior-design service that paired customers with a human designer and a shoppable 3D render, shut down its design business in 2022. Founder Shanna Tellerman announced the wind-down in late June 2022, with the company ceasing operations around July 6 after an expected acquisition deal fell through (TechCrunch, Business of Home). Modsy had raised more than $72 million since launching in 2015. Customers mid-project lost access to their designers and 3D models, and refunds were directed to a Google Form. It is genuinely gone, so this guide covers what to use instead.

Is there a service like Modsy that still uses human designers?
Yes. Havenly, Decorilla and Spacejoy all still pair you with a real designer and deliver a plan plus a shopping list, which is the core of what Modsy did. Havenly is the closest match on model and price, with an online room package at $199 and in-person service from $699, plus a free AI tier. Decorilla is the premium option at $299 per room and gives you concepts from more than one designer, with trade discounts. Spacejoy is the most 3D-render-focused, also from $299 per room, with delivery in about 7 to 10 days. Prices web-verified August 2026.

Can I still get a refund or recover my in-progress Modsy project?
It is very unlikely in 2026. When Modsy shut down in mid-2022, it directed refund requests to a Google Form and said refunds could take one to two weeks, but many customers reported orders and refunds left in limbo as the company ceased operations (TechCrunch). Because Modsy no longer operates, there is no active support channel to recover a project or design files now.
